Access to handwashing facilities in Suriname, 2015–2022
Source: WHO/UNICEF Joint Monitoring Programme for Water Supply, Sanitation and Hygiene (2025) – processed by Our World in Data. Measured in %.
Analysis
In 2022, access to handwashing facilities in Suriname stood at 72.1%. That is the highest value across all 8 years on record.
The figure is up 0.0% over ten years.
Suriname ranks 54th of 113 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
